Transaction 16e268a21f5c16520d5a14ac127bfee6c8a2161a40c43b9cb69c6c143d55dd63
1 Input
1 Output
-
16e268a21f5c16520d5a14ac127bfee6c8a2161a40c43b9cb69c6c143d55dd63:0
- value
- 384712
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0695815f27b319d01932c80139afe13f5b92ef0 OP_EQUAL
- address
- 3KEProxsvQ5DdfaXURJ6W1HnuNxUEUbLdy